Job description
Position Summary

Centrally based within our busy Finance department at Worksop, Nottinghamshire. This is an excellent opportunity for a suitably experienced finance/revenues specialist to join our Transactional Finance Team.

Responsibilities
  • Provide a high quality service to our customers covering the specific areas of council tax and business rates enforcement, accounts receivables, housing benefit overpayments, housing and garage rent collection and former tenant arrears.
Qualifications
  • 5 GCSE's (Grade C or above / L4‑9 equivalence), including Maths and English; computer literate with experience using Microsoft Office packages.
  • Experience of working within a finance environment is essential.
  • Excellent communication skills; ability to analyse data effectively, work under pressure and in difficult situations.
